Issue notice. Learned APP waives service for Respondent-State. Perused case diary. By consent of parties heard finally. 2.
Learned counsel for applicant submitted that this Court by it's order dated 12/4/2018 in ABA No.595/2018 has protected co-accused Ajit Ahir, Milind Ahir and Anil Ahir, who are real brothers of applicant and had contended that role attributed to applicant and other co-accused is similar and has thus, contended that applicant be protected. 3.
It is case of prosecution that whenever prosecutrix used to return from school along with her minor friends applicant along with other co-accused harass them by coming there on their motorcycle and use to touch them inappropriately on their head and whistled towards them. However, prosecutrix did not disclose said fact till 27/12/2018 when there was quarrel amongst applicant, other co-accused and their parents with complainant. Learned APP further while opposing the application had referred to statement of Kshitij,brother of prosecutrix and had contended
rsk 2/2 913-ABA-758-18.doc that as per his statement applicant wanted him (Kshitij) to speak to prosecutrix to marry applicant. However, except for this the case of applicant is at par with that of other co-accused who are granted anticipatory bail.
4.
Considering involvement of applicant as aforesaid, following order is passed:
ORDER
i) In the event of arrest applicant, he shall be released on bail on his executing P.R. Bond in the sum of Rs.25,000/- with one surety in the like amount;
ii) While on bail applicant shall attend Investigating Officer as and when called till filing of charge-sheet;
iii) Application is disposed of as allowed.
